Changes in dermal capillary blood flow and blood oxygen deliver to deep tissue in response to a brief period of hypoxia will be studied in normal controls and subjects with sickle cell anemia. These responses will be standardized so they can later be used to study pharmacological interventions that may improve blood flow and oxygen delivery. Blood oxygen level delivery will be measured by magnetic resonance imaging and dermal capillary blood flow will be measured using laser-Doppler flow.
